verliezen
To lose.
Here, 'verliezen' (to lose) is used in the context of a competition or game, indicating the undesired outcome.
Ik wil niet verliezen, ik wil winnen.
I do not want to lose, I want to win.
In this sentence, 'verloren' (lost) is the past participle of 'verliezen,' used to express misplacement of an object.
Hij kan zijn bril niet vinden; hij denkt dat hij ze verloren heeft.
He cannot find his glasses; he thinks he has lost them.
